..... roperty of the company, and as such, the question of sale of such materials by the appellant (respondent herein), does not arise." It was further held that: "On a consideration of the intention of the parties taken as a whole, one has to irresistibly conclude that it is a works contract, in which, use of materials is incidental to the execution of the work and it is not a contract involving sale of goods. The contract is an entire and indivisible contract as the consideration for the entire work of breaking and producing prescribed different grades and sizes of boulders, transporting goods to the work-spot and placing them in lines and levels as shown in the drawing and as directed by the contractor, is the payment of all inclusive lump .....

..... the Port Trust and therefore, there is absolutely no scope whatsoever, to hold that the dominant object is the supply of boulders. The main and essential part of the contract is to fix those materials in accordance with the directions and instructions given on the spot by the engineering personnel of the department. The case of Anamolu Seshagiri Rao Company v. State of Andhra Pradesh [1980] 45 STC 388, on which the learned Government Pleader places reliance, is of little assistance to him, because there the court was dealing with a situation whereunder the contract with the railways entered into by the assessee was for the supply and stacking of hard stone ballast of particular size at specified places along side the railway tracks, an .....
